38 I’ve been with you these twenty years. Your ewes and female goats have not miscarried, and I have not eaten the rams from your flock.

39 I did not bring you any of the flock torn by wild beasts; I myself bore the loss. You demanded payment from me for what was stolen by day or by night.

40 There I was—the heat consumed me by day and the frost by night, and sleep fled from my eyes.

41 For twenty years in your household I served you—fourteen years for your two daughters and six years for your flocks —and you have changed my wages ten times!

42 If the God of my father, the God of Abraham, the Fear of Isaac, had not been with me, certainly now you would have sent me off empty-handed. But God has seen my affliction and my hard work, and he issued his verdict last night.”
